RequirementsThe ideal candidate has experience building 0-to-1 products, demonstrating a strong ability to design and implement scalable architectures that support rapid product evolutionCandidates with backgrounds in early-stage software products engineered for scale or those who have worked in Research & Development for new technologies will fit well in our teamBachelor’s (or higher, e.g., MS, or PhD) in Computer Science or a related technical field involving coding or equivalent technical experienceExpert-level proficiency in modern frontend development, including HTML, CSS, JavaScript, TypeScript, React, and Next.jsStrong experience with frontend architecture, including state management, component design, design systems, micro-frontends (or modular architectures), and performance optimizationExperience building and operating production web applications using server-side and client-side renderingDeep understanding of software engineering best practices across the SDLC, including testing, code reviews, observability, and operational excellence4+ years of industry experience, with significant depth in frontend or web platform developmentExperience working in cloud-based environments (AWS, GCP, or Azure), particularly as it relates to frontend delivery and integrationExperience using AI-assisted development tools (e.g., Copilot, Cursor, LLMs) is a plusWhat the job involvesWe seek an experienced, collaborative, and resourceful Senior Web Engineer to join our team. Our Early Bets initiatives are critical to EarnIn’s success, providing new experiences and products for our users to ensure they are empowered with a more comprehensive ecosystem of solutionsWe seek engineers who thrive in uncertainty and excel at defining technical solutions in ambiguous environments and collaborating closely with Product teams to refine requirementsPartner with Product and Design to define, build, and evolve user experiences using modern frontend technologiesOwn and evolve the frontend architecture to ensure scalability, performance, accessibility, and long-term maintainabilityLead the design and implementation of complex frontend systems using React, TypeScript, and Next.js, including SSR, routing, data fetching, and performance optimizationEstablish and uphold frontend engineering standards, including patterns, tooling, testing strategies, and CI/CD best practicesDrive cross-team technical initiatives, aligning frontend architecture with backend APIs, platform capabilities, and product strategyProactively identify technical risks and opportunities, providing clear technical direction and tradeoff analysisMentor and guide frontend engineers, raising the bar on code quality, architectural thinking, and delivery practicesDesign and implement robust unit, integration, and UI automation tests to ensure reliability and confidence at scaleDefine and monitor frontend metrics (performance, reliability, user behavior) to inform product and technical decisions#J-18808-Ljbffr